PF will subpoena Lula’s former GSI to testify on performance in 1/8 – 04/19/2023 – Power
[ad_1]
The Federal Police will summon the now former head of the GSI (Institutional Security Office), General Gonçalves Dias, better known as GDias, to testify in the coming days.
He resigned from his position this Wednesday afternoon (19), after the release of images that put the body’s performance in check during the coup act on January 8.
His departure from the government occurred shortly after a meeting with President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va (PT).
Hours before the resignation, CNN Brasil had released images of the internal security circuit of the Palácio do Planalto during the invasion of the headquarters of the Presidency of the Republic.
The PF investigates the omission of authorities within an inquiry opened by the STF (Federal Supreme Court). The rapporteur of the case in court is Minister Alexandre de Moraes.
The general’s departure comes after a series of meetings at the Planalto Palace. GDias tried to justify himself throughout the day to fellow ministers, but the assessment is that his permanence was unsustainable and that it brought a lot of fragility to the government’s speech in front of Bolsonaristas.
